Shut off the main water valve, turn off electricity if water is near outlets or appliances, contain water with buckets or towels, and contact emergency plumbing support right away to minimize damage.

Hydro-jetting uses high-pressure water to clear heavy build-up and tree roots from sewer and drain lines. It’s recommended when roots, grease, or mineral deposits cause recurrent clogs that snaking cannot fully clear.
Signs include multiple slow or backed-up drains in the home, persistent sewer odors, gurgling noises from drains, unusually green or soggy spots in the yard, and sudden increases in water bills; a camera inspection is the best way to diagnose the problem.
